The 2N4342 Datasheet serves as the definitive guide to understanding this N-Channel JFET. It’s more than just a list of numbers; it’s a blueprint for how the device behaves under various conditions. By carefully examining the parameters outlined within the datasheet, one can predict its performance in a circuit, ensuring stable and reliable operation. Understanding and referencing this datasheet is crucial for avoiding potential pitfalls and maximizing the efficiency of any project employing the 2N4342. It provides essential information, like:
- Maximum voltage ratings (drain-source, gate-source)
- Maximum current ratings (drain current)
- Operating temperature range
Datasheets are crucial for circuit design. They allow engineers to select components that meet the specific requirements of their applications. Without the information provided in the 2N4342 Datasheet, it would be impossible to predict how the JFET would perform under different operating conditions. This includes considerations like temperature, voltage, and current, which all affect the transistor’s behavior. Here are a few areas where a datasheet comes in handy:
- Amplifier circuits (low-noise preamplifiers)
- Switching applications
- Voltage-controlled resistors
